Councilman Glass seconded the motion <br />Motion carried. <br />ORDINANCE NO. 4443 - - -62 <br />AN ORDINANCE ANNEXING TO AND BRINGING WITHIN THE CITY LIMITS OF SOUTH BEND, <br />INDIANA, CERTAIN LANDS (2 acres of land on Edison east of Ironwood) <br />The Ordinance was given third reading and passed by a roll call vote of 9 ayes and 0 nays. <br />ORDINANCE NO. 4444 - - -62 <br />AN ORDINANCE AMENDING AND SUPPLEMENTING ZONING ORDINANCE NO. 3702, AS <br />HERETOFORE AMENDED AND SUPPLEMENTED <br />(All but the northwest corner of the block bounded by Wayne, Taylor <br />Scott and Western Avenue) <br />The Ordinance was given third reading and passed by a roll call vote of 9 ayes and 0 nays. <br />REPORT OF CITY PLANNING COMMISSION <br />March 8, 1962 <br />The Honorable Common Council <br />City of South Bend <br />South Bend, Indiana <br />Gentlemen: <br />The attached petition of the City Planning Commission to zone the recently annexed land being more generally describ( <br />as being a parcel of land on the east side of Ironwood Road 660 feet north and south by 355 feet east and west and <br />lying 620 feet north of Edison Road "C" Commercial Use and "A" Height and Area District was legally advertised under <br />date of February 19, 1962 and given public hearing on March 1, 1962. The following action was taken: <br />After due consideration the Commission found that the property in question lies between existing commercial <br />zoning, that it was commercially zoned in the County, that there is an apparent need for additional commercial <br />zoning in the general area, and`that the best use of subject land would be commercial. It was therefore duly <br />moved, seconded, and unanimously carried that the petition be recommended favorably to the Council. <br />Very truly yours, <br />CITY PLANNING COMMISSION <br />/s/ Robert L.
